What is BS 3293 - Carbon steel pipe flanges (over 24 inches nominal size) for the petroleum industry about?  

BS 3293 is a material and dimensional standard only and applies to forged carbon steel slip-on and welding neck flanges of nominal sizes 26 in and larger, for use in the petroleum industry. Drilling, bolting, facing and thickness dimensions are applicable also to integral end flanges of valve and fittings. 

Four classes of flanges are provided, namely Classes 150, 300, 400, and 600. 

Note: BS 3293 does not include pressure/temperature ratings; the flange designations quoted are for identification purposes only.

Why should you use BS 3293 - Carbon steel pipe flanges (over 24 inches nominal size) for the petroleum industry? 

Flanges in BS 3293 are designated as Classes 150, 300, 400, and 600 to facilitate ordering and to ensure interchangeability. 

BS 3293 provides guidance on the designation and pressure-temperature ratings, materials for flanges, dimensions, and tolerances, flange facings and gaskets, Spot-facing and back-facing of flanges, inspection, preparation, and despatch. This enables manufacturers to achieve a quality product.
